# PlausibleBA Orchestrator Skill
> **Note:** This skill coordinates ba-capability-mapping, ba-concept-model, and
> ba-value-streams. Read those skills if anything here is unclear about phase behaviour.
## Purpose
Run the complete PlausibleBA stack as a single guided session. The user provides one
business description; the skill produces three artefacts and one bundle, with minimal
interruption.
**Design principle:** The user should always know where they are and what's coming next.
Each phase begins with a progress header. Downloads are deferred until the bundle is
complete. Checkpoints are decisive — one per phase (except capability mapping which
needs two: L1/L2 before L3).

## Phase 1 — Capability Map
Follow the ba-capability-mapping SKILL.md elicitation process with these modifications:
**Checkpoints:** Two (1A for L1/L2, 1B for full L3 map) — same as standalone skill.
**Visualisation:** Render treemap after Checkpoint 1B is confirmed. Same spec as standalone.
**Handoff:** At phase end, extract and carry forward:
- The confirmed L3 capability list (id, name, businessObject)
- The full list of business objects identified in Step 2
Do NOT offer XLSX or JSON download. Say:
> *"Capability map complete — [N] capabilities across [N] domains. Moving to Phase 2."*
Then display the Phase 2 progress header immediately.
---
## Phase 2 — Concept Model
Follow the ba-concept-model SKILL.md elicitation process with these modifications:
**Seeding:** Pre-populate the object list from the business objects carried forward from
Phase 1. Present them to the user as a starting point rather than starting from scratch:
> *"From the capability map we already have [N] business objects identified: [list].
> I'll classify these and check for anything missing."*
**Checkpoint:** One — present the classified objects and relationships before rendering.
**Visualisation:** Render concept graph after Checkpoint 2 is confirmed.
**Cross-validation:** Run against Phase 1 capabilities automatically (no user prompt needed).
**Handoff:** Carry forward the typed object list (id, name, type: Party/Resource/Record).
Do NOT offer XLSX or JSON download. Say:
> *"Concept model complete — [N] objects ([N] Party, [N] Resource, [N] Record). Moving to Phase 3."*
Then display the Phase 3 progress header immediately.
---
## Phase 3 — Value Stream
Follow the ba-value-streams SKILL.md elicitation process with these modifications:
**Seeding:** Use Phase 1 capabilities and Phase 2 objects as the source for stage
capability mapping and value object identification. Do not re-elicit what is already known.
**Checkpoint:** One — present the stage draft with entry/exit states and mapped capabilities.
**Visualisation:** Render stage view after Checkpoint 3 is confirmed.
**Cross-validation:** Flag unused capabilities from Phase 1 automatically.
After Checkpoint 3 is confirmed and the stage view is rendered, say:
> *"Value stream complete — [N] stages. Ready to package the bundle."*
Then proceed directly to the Bundle step.

## Error Handling
**User wants to skip a phase:** Allow it. Say "Skipping [phase] — you can run `/[command]`
later if needed" and proceed. The bundle will be partial; note which elements are missing.
**User wants to redo a phase:** Allow it. Re-run the phase from its progress header.
Previous phase outputs are preserved.
**Input is too sparse to start Phase 1:** Ask one question only — "What is this business
or initiative?" — before proceeding.
**Long or complex domains:** If a domain has >8 L1 areas, pause and suggest scoping:
"This looks like a large enterprise. Shall we scope to a specific business unit or
division, or continue with the full enterprise map?"
---
## What This Skill Does NOT Do
- Does not offer downloads mid-session (deferred to Bundle step)
- Does not re-elicit information already established in a previous phase
- Does not run the three skills as independent sessions — context carries through
- Does not produce partial bundles without noting which elements are missing
